Prosper uses Vertical Response (www.verticalresponse.com) to send out their e-mail's like that. What you see there is a standard Vertical Response tracking link. I use Vertical Response to send out newsletters for several of my clients, so I'm pretty familiar with their service.
The link there doesn't track you specifically (AFIK), but it does track clicks in general (which is why it's going to vertical response's servers). The tracking stuff allows Prosper to log in and see how many people opened the e-mail, how many people clicked on the links, which links were clicked most frequently, etc. to gauge how effective their mailings are.

If that were the case I would expect my link to be identical to j9359's, but it is different. Here's mine:
http://cts.vresp.com/c/?ProsperMarketplaceIn/be6178f4fb/9f77934d91/f07b0980c6/
listingID=293344&
utm_medium=email&utm_campaign=marketing_featured_listing&
utm_source=featured_listing_20080318_V1&
utm_content=photo_293344
be6178f4fb is the same, so perhaps that identifies the mailing
f07b0980c6, the last of the three numbers, is different between each link in my email but matches the link an another member's email, so that's unlikely - it probably identifies which link is clicked
9f77934d91, the middle number, is the same in all links in my email. Hmmm.
